Isabel Duarte
Institution: Universidad Rey Juan Carlos/Universidad de Almería
Country: Spain
Isabel Duarte Tosso is a Ph.D. student from the University of Almería, currently working on her thesis in the field of the didactics of Mathematics.
She graduated in Mathematics from the University of Sevilla in 2014. The following year she completed the Master’s degree in Mathematics and the Master’s degree in Teaching Secondary Education, both from the University of Málaga.
As of now, she is currently working at Rey Juan Carlos University, in Madrid.
Isabel's field of research is quite varied. Her main line of research is Women in Mathematics, subject about which she is developing her doctoral thesis. She is also researching about other topics such as didactical analysis of textbooks.
Areas of expertise: Mathematics education, teaching and learning, teacher training, secondary education.
